Method for preparing mineral wool fibers from leaching residues of hydrometallurgy laterite-nickel ore and application of mineral wool fibers
The invention discloses a method for preparing mineral wool fibers from leaching residues of hydrometallurgy laterite-nickel ore and application of the mineral wool fibers. According to the method, leaching residues of the hydrometallurgy laterite-nickel ore are adopted as a raw material, a conditioning agent is added into the raw material, normal-temperature solid-state mixing and conditioning are performed to enable the acidity coefficient to be greater than or equal to 1.2, and then mixed material melting, discharging and filamentation are performed to obtain the mineral wool fibers; or, the leaching residues of the hydrometallurgy laterite-nickel ore are used as raw materials, and the raw materials are fused, discharged and filamented to obtain the mineral wool fibers. The method can reduce solid waste and environmental pollution, is used for preparing rock wool, improves the heat insulation performance of buildings, improves the energy utilization rate and reduces energy consumption.
